Genus of over 200 species of rosette-forming monocarpic perennials and succulents of desert and mountainous regions of North and Central America. Agave ovatifolia is a medium-sized plant with a generally single body, rarely clustered. Compact rosette up to 80-120 cm large, made up of enlarged, oval, blue-grey leaves with small marginal spines and a black apical spine. After 15-20 years the plant produces an apical inflorescence up to 5-6 m high with numerous yellow flowers. After flowering the plant withers and dies.
Pedoclimatic needs
Given its small size and the absence of lateral or root shoots, this species is particularly suitable for cultivation in large pots or flower beds. Grow in well-drained soil preferably with a good limestone content and enriched with a little organic substance. Watering must be regular from March to September, suspending it in the winter months. It prefers full sun exposure. This species is fairly rustic and tolerates frosts as long as they are not too intense and prolonged down to -4°/-6°c. During the dry season it resists drought well, although it benefits from regular irrigation by waiting for the earth to dry between one irrigation and another.Botanical Information
